Description: The raw aluminium Kaweco Sport closely follows an original, super compact, 1935 octagonal design. The metallic body made of high quality aluminium gives this writing instrument an elegant surface. Due to the low weight, the model is ideal for travelling. 'Small in the pocket, large in the hand', the oversized cap arrangement creates a small closed pen but a full length open pen. Closed, the pen is just 105mm long, open 130mm long with a 14mm diameter barrel (around the cap). Made in Germany, the pen features a screw-on cap for extra security, a chrome-plated steel nib with iridium tip, and a metal Kaweco logo on the cap tip. - Pen Size Closed: 105mm - Pen Size Open: 130mm - Brand: Kaweco - Pen Colour: Raw Aluminium - Nib Size: Medium - Country of Manufacture: Germany - Metal display tin and black ink cartridge included. Review: I just love this pen. I've neve owned a Kaweco before but have wanted one for a long time and I finally took the plunge. I really love this little pen. It writes well, so far, no leakage and is comfortable to use. I use the ink converter rather than the cartridges as I prefer that and I think it's more eco friendly as the plastic footprint is much smaller. One bottle of ink goes a long, long way, whilst small cartridges don't. Anyway, back the pen. I bought the distress metallic blue one and it doesn't disappoint. Colour is really nice and because it's distressed, I needn't worry about scratch marks, etc. Bonus. Some people have said the AL Sport pens are heavy but frankly, I have no idea what they are talking about. At least mine isn't. Obviously, the pen can be used with the lid snapped onto the back or not. Personally, I prefer it off. Some may find it too short without. Personal preference. A good fountain pen, and a good size to keep in your pocket if a standard size is too big. Love the tin it comes in, too.
